Celebrating Daniel Devers: A Beacon of Financial Literacy and Leadership


Daniel Devers has become a noteworthy figure in the realms of finance and leadership development. His journey, which began in 2010 in the financial sector and in 2009 with coaching athletics, has been driven by an earnest desire to enrich others’ lives through financial literacy and personal growth.

Roles and Responsibilities

Daniel’s day-to-day activities span a broad spectrum. He educates on financial wisdom in various settings and coaches aspirants in both his industry and in sports. His objective? To unlock the potential in others so they can effectively benefit those around them.

Skills that Make a Difference

What makes Daniel exceptional? His ability to listen, motivate, and inspire. These skills are fundamental in fostering both individual transformations and broader community enhancements.

A Heart for the Community

Help people get where they want to go, and you will in turn get where you want to go,” advises Daniel, encapsulating his philosophy. His passion goes beyond personal achievements—it’s about aiding others in redefining their relationship with money and identity enhancement.
